JSSC Para Teacher Eligibility Criteria
All applicants must meet the specified educational and professional prerequisites for their target post. Please review the detailed post-wise eligibility criteria listed below to ensure your qualifications align with the requirements.
| Post Name | Eligibility Criteria |
|---|---|
| Intermediate Trained Assistant Teacher (Class 1–5) | Passed 10+2 (Intermediate) with the required marks and one of the prescribed teacher education qualifications such as D.El.Ed./Diploma in Elementary Education/B.El.Ed./Special Education or Graduation with D.El.Ed., along with qualification in JTET/CTET as prescribed in the notification. |
| Graduate Trained Assistant Teacher (Class 6–8) – Language | Graduation in the relevant language subject with B.Ed./Integrated B.Ed. or other prescribed teacher education qualification along with JTET/CTET as applicable. |
| Graduate Trained Assistant Teacher (Class 6–8) – Social Science | Graduation with Social Science-related subjects and B.Ed./Integrated B.Ed. or equivalent teacher education qualification along with JTET/CTET as prescribed. |
| Graduate Trained Assistant Teacher (Class 6–8) – Science & Mathematics | Graduation in Science/Mathematics or relevant subjects with B.Ed./Integrated B.Ed. or equivalent teacher education qualification along with JTET/CTET as prescribed. |
Age Limit
The minimum age requirement for all teaching posts is 21 years. Maximum age limits are category-specific, with all calculations based on the reference date of 01 August 2025.

JSSC Para Teacher Selection Process
The selection procedure for the JSSC JTAACCE Para Teacher Recruitment 2026 follows these structured stages:
- Written Examination (JTAACCE-2026)
- Preparation of Merit List based on the marks obtained in the examination.
- Document Verification of shortlisted candidates.
- Final Selection based on merit, eligibility, reservation rules, and successful document verification.
Important Documents Required
- Valid Photo ID (Aadhaar Card, Voter ID, or PAN Card)
- Recent passport-sized photograph & signature
- Class 10th, 12th, and Graduation marksheets/certificates
- Professional qualification certificates (D.El.Ed / B.Ed)
- JTET / CTET / State TET pass certificate
- Jharkhand Domicile Certificate (if claiming state reservation)
- Category / Caste Certificate (if applicable)
- Disability Certificate (if applicable)
Jharkhand Para Teacher Salary 2026
Successful candidates will be recruited under the Department of School Education and Literacy, Jharkhand. Compensation packages will be determined based on the applicable pay scale for each specific post.
| Post Level | Pay Scale / Pay Band | Pay Level | Starting Basic Pay |
| Intermediate Trained Teacher (Classes 1–5) | ₹25,500 – ₹81,100 | Level 4 | ₹25,500 / month |
| Graduate Trained Teacher (Classes 6–8) | ₹29,200 – ₹92,300 | Level 5 | ₹29,200 / month |
JSSC JTAACCE Para Teacher Recruitment 2026
The recruitment drive encompasses a total of 7,299 vacancies, consisting of 6,101 regular positions and 1,198 backlog Assistant Teacher posts.
The online application window was initially scheduled to open on 31 July 2026 and conclude on 30 August 2026. Please watch for official updates regarding revised submission dates.
Applicants must be at least 21 years of age. Depending on their category, the maximum age limit ranges from 40 to 45 years, with age eligibility verified as of 01 August 2025.
The selection process consists of a competitive written examination, the publication of a merit list, rigorous document verification, and final appointments based on reservation policies and eligibility standards.
The application fee is set at Rs. 100 for UR/EBC-I/BC-II/EWS candidates, and Rs. 50 for SC/ST candidates who are Jharkhand residents. PwD candidates with a disability rating of 40% or higher are exempt from all application fees.
